Python之format格式化输出
生活随笔
收集整理的這篇文章主要介紹了
Python之format格式化输出
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
一、兩種順序
二、格式
(輸出大括號)
?<格式控制標記>包括:<填充><對齊><寬度>,<.精度><類型>6個字段,這些字段都是可選的,可以組合使用。 ?<填充>、<對齊>和<寬度>是3個相關字段。 ?<寬度>指當前槽的設定輸出字符寬度,如果該槽對應的format()參數長度比<寬度>設定值大,則使用參數實際長度。如果該值的實際位數小于指定寬度,則位數將被默認以空格字符補充。 ?<對齊>指參數在<寬度>內輸出時的對齊方式,分別使用<、>和^三個符號表示左對齊、右對齊和居中對齊。 ?<填充>指<寬度>內除了參數外的字符采用什么方式表示,默認采用空格,可以通過<填充>更換。 ?<.精度>表示兩個含義,由小數點(.)開頭。對于浮點數,精度表示小數部分輸出的有效位數。對于字符串,精度表示輸出的最? ? ? 大長度 ?<類型>表示輸出整數和浮點數類型的格式規則。 b: 輸出整數的二進制方式; c: 輸出整數對應的Unicode字符; d: 輸出整數的十進制方式; o: 輸出整數的八進制方式; x: 輸出整數的小寫十六進制方式;X: 輸出整數的大寫十六進制方式;
?對于浮點數類型,輸出格式包括4種: e: 輸出浮點數對應的小寫字母e的指數形式; E: 輸出浮點數對應的大寫字母E的指數形式; f: 輸出浮點數的標準浮點形式; %: 輸出浮點數的百分形式。 ?浮點數輸出時盡量使用<.精度>表示小數部分的寬度,有助于更好控制輸出格式。總結
以上是生活随笔為你收集整理的Python之format格式化输出的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Web前端之登录表单
- 下一篇: Webstorm/PhpStorm打开多